Abstract
The utility model discloses a kind of doll machines, including gripper frame, horizontal overline bridge track and fore-and-aft bridge, it is characterized in that it is movably set with Hanging roller in horizontal overline bridge track, the lower end of Hanging roller is connected with transverse shifting cage, the lower end of transverse shifting cage is provided with telescopic sleeving rod A, B, C, more stamens are provided between transverse shifting cage and gripper frame and spirally cover line, folding decelerating motor, bolt sleeve and nut are provided in gripper frame, the lower end of nut is fixed with briquetting, and the nut on the upside of briquetting is provided outside magnetic coil;Gripper is each provided at left and right sides of gripper frame, interior lower end on the upside of the gripper of both sides is respectively movably set with compression roller bearing, the one side of briquetting is provided with /V slide-bar, and the opposite side of briquetting is provided with travel switch gag lever post, and the upper and lower of travel switch gag lever post is each provided with folding travel switch.Its advantage is simple in structure, science, rationally, can accurately set the grip of gripper.

The falling of folding decelerating motor 15, clockwise controllable briquetting 18 it is upper and lower, gripper 1 is opened during pushing, rises gripper 1
Close up;The grip of doll machine most importantly gripper, the existing gripper similar with the design of Japan just without magnetic coil,
Grip by the weight of gripper, weight is bigger, grip it is also bigger, but this is fixed, it is impossible to be adjusted;Magnetic force
The setting of coil 19 can adjust the magnetic force of magnetic coil 19 by the intensity of variable-current, so that briquetting 18 has magnetic force attraction
Roller bearing 12 in gripper 1, magnetic force is bigger, and the grip of gripper 1 is also bigger;
